Ricoh Caplio R40 review
Ricoh arrives this year with its new model, the Ricoh Caplio R40 which is a great camera and setting new standards in the camera industry! It was shown on the North American market on the 22/5/06. This model measures 95 x 53 x 26 mm while weights 165 g. The Caplio R40 has for maximum resolution 2816 x 2112. It can also be set at a lower resolution of 2048 x 1563, 1280 x 960, 640 x 480. The ratio of the image (w/h) on the Ricoh Caplio R40 is 4:3, 3:2, making a total of 6.0 mega pixels. The lens's sensor of the Caplio R40 is a CCD which measures only 1/2.5 " with a RGB color filter. Ricoh included a digital zoom on the Caplio R40 and also added an internal flash being very common in new cameras .
The normal focus range is 30 cm. The minimum shutter speed (min. exposition to light) on the Caplio R40 was set at 8 seconds and the maximum shutter speed is 1/2000 seconds. Movie clips are also supported in this model which is always a useful function. The Ricoh Caplio R40 includes an internal memory of 26 mb extendable by using SD/MMC card + Internal. The LCD screen of the Caplio R40 measures 2.5 ". A video out plug exists allowing you to watch your favorite pictures on television.
